Why You Shouldn't Limit Yourself in Fanfiction

One of the defining aspects of fanfiction is the freedom to explore your creativity without constraints. Unlike conventional writing, where the audience is broad and the expectations vary, fanfiction is a space where you are the only audience. There are no external pressures or limitations imposed by editors, publishers, or critics. This unique environment allows you to experiment, make mistakes, and uncover why certain tropes have become clichés. It's a melting pot of personal feelings and desires, offering a safe space to delve into complex emotions and narratives.

2. Authenticity Matters: Understand Your Subject Matter

When writing about subjects outside your expertise, such as scientific or academic topics, it's essential to do thorough research. For example, if you're writing a fanfiction involving scientific research in a real-world setting, ensure that your depiction aligns with established scientific principles and practices. While fiction allows for creative liberties, inaccuracies can detract from the narrative and potentially harm your SEO efforts. Readers and search engines value accuracy and reliability. Therefore, if you're unsure, it's better to seek guidance or consult experts in the field.

3. Be Mindful of Personal Biases

While creative writing offers a platform to express personal views, it's wise to exercise caution when it comes to sensitive subjects like politics and religion. It's nearly impossible to remain completely unbiased, but strive to present a balanced perspective that enhances the story rather than detracts from it. For instance, if your story involves extreme religious or political factions, include characters or events that provide a counterbalance to the negative aspects.
